My Predictions for 2009
From what I can asses, here are my predictions for Nissan/Infiniti for 2009...
-G35 Sedan becomes G37 Sedan, gets VQ37VHR, 330HP
-G37 Coupe gets more power, 350HP
-Nissan 370Z gets updated G37 Coupe motor, also at 350HP
-M37 and FX37 receive the G37 Sedan motor, 330HP
-M50 and FX50 get all new 5.0L V8
-New 6AT reveiled, will be standard on M,G,FX, and new Z.
-Possible concept of the new Q.

However, while there's a good chance it or a smaller 6A/T will find its way into the '09 FX, it will NOT find its way into the G, M or Z. Again the Z and M are so close to their redesigns that it's not worth the cost of R&D to try and fit the trans into these cars. With that being said there's no way Nissan would throw a trans with more gears into the G without it first going into the FX AND the M. And since it'll more than likely only show up in the FX, it's doubtful the G will get it as well. It's call trickle down for a reason, not trickle up.
